PANJIM: Agitated Goans in Paris, deeply distressed with the happenings in the motherland, given their deep devotion to St Francis Xavier, condemned the atrocious statement of Subhash Velingkar against Goencho Saib St Francis Xavier. The protest was held outside St Francis Xavier Church, in Paris opposite the St Francis Xavier Metro Railway station.
They confessed their deep devotion to the saint who is highly venerated in Goa, and said this devotion continues in Paris since the nail of St Francis Xavier is kept in this St Francis Xavier Church in Paris. They praised Goans in Goa for organizing the protests, especially in Salcete, Bardez and all over Goa, in the name of Goans in Paris.
After singing the popular hymn, San Francis Xaviera outside the St Francis Xavier Church in Paris, one gentleman said, “ We are glad to inform you that a nail of St Francis Xavier is kept here as a relic and it is displayed for veneration only on December 3, every year. All these Goans in Paris gathered here with just one message and we thank all the activists in Goa for awakening the government, but the government has not listened since though the FIR has been filed Velingkar has not been arrested. We are looking forward to his arrest.”
In Guirdolim, parishioners had a candlelit procession and recited the Holy Rosary in the St Francis Xavier Chapel compound. They prayed for forgiveness for Subhash Velingkar despite the hurtful remarks made by him against St Francis Xavier.
